A 7,500-square-foot multimedia palace, Treehouse Sound helps amateur and professional musicians to unleash their creative vision with recording, video, and web services. The state-of-the-art recording studio, which has captured the sounds of previous clients such as Gym Class Heroes, The Gaslight Anthem, and Run-DMC, brims with enough gadgetry to make RoboCop swoon. The long list of equipment includes a Pro Tools HD2 system with Waves Mercury plug-ins, microphones including a Neumann U87 and a Shure SM7, and preamps from Neve and Focusrite. Musicians abandon homemade cardboard-box drums and tinfoil guitars for the studio’s high-end instruments, among them Gibson guitars, Slingerland and Tama drums, Ampeg and Fender amps, and an Allan Lawrence upright piano. A 2,000-square-foot rehearsal space, a lounge, a full kitchen, and extended-stay housing facilitate long-term creative projects, from writing and recording an album to filming a documentary on chia-head growth. Knowledgeable staffers can also help to polish albums with arranging, mixing, and mastering services and also dabble in video production and personalized web design.
Though Orlando expected his trip to Ground Zero to be a meaningful one, it wasn't until afterward that the visit profoundly changed his life. He had snapped some photos of the site, and upon seeing the proofs he was spellbound; their power convinced him to pursue photography professionally. Today he is more likely to be found shooting lovebirds than landmarks, as he mostly channels his passion into capturing weddings. However, the elements of realism that initially inspired Orlando still shape his work; he's been known to catch stolen moments such as a ring bearer scowling as a grownup adjusts his suit buttons, and a bride beaming as she gets a first glimpse of her freshly applied makeup. Like an alarm clock that gives wet willies, his style has not gone unnoticed—Orlando boasts Bride's Choice Awards from WeddingWire for 2010, 2011, and 2012.
